[ Who is Blaize? ]

Blaize was born in Johannesburg, South Africa, but now lives in the small town of Paraparaumu in New Zealand. As an undergraduate, he studied Classics, Philosophy, and Logic after which he did graduate work in cognitive science (where he paid people to play Tetris for hours). He has spent the last decade writing PHP applications, and proudly continues doing so as a developer for Amazee.

[ More on Amazee.io hosting service ]

The need for a dedicated Drupal hosting solution powered the development of amazee.io. Initiated as an internal service at Amazee Labs, a global Drupal and React specialist, it served the Group’s requirement to host locally for clients with high data privacy regulations.

Today, the system is being used by external agencies and organizations across the globe. We are proud to provide the flexibility of a container-based hosting platform as well as expert support. We created the hosting platform we wanted to see in the world.
